The FinOps Analyst is responsible for setting up processes and tools that will ensure visibility and action based on accurate and timely data to our business. Overall, this role requires deep cloud billing understanding, collaboration with many teams, heavy data analysis, and excellent communication skills. Success in these efforts should result in changed processes and maturing governance of cloud usage, and the work must be done continually from a positive, business-enhancing stance.

Key responsibilities:

Cost Management: • Monitor and analyze cloud-related expenses, identifying cost optimization and offset opportunities • Implement and maintain cost control strategies and practices Budgeting and Forecasting: • Support the cloud monthly budget and forecast process in managing consumption, show back, and savings in collaboration with accounting, finance, and technical owners • Forecast cloud costs based on usage trends and project requirements • Ensure alignment of cloud spending with budgetary constraints Resource Optimization: • Analyze cloud usage patterns and make recommendations for resource allocation and utilization improvements. This will include investigating and escalating anomalies and unplanned consumption spikes • Identify strategies to adapt resources to demand, optimizing cost and performance • Identify underutilized or unused resources and recommend decommissioning when appropriate Data Analysis: • Collect and analyze data related to cloud spending and usage • Provide insights and recommendations to reduce unnecessary spending during recurring portfolio reviews • Create and maintain financial reports and dashboards • Extract actionable insights to drive informed decision-making Collaboration & Communication: • Work closely with product teams to provide insights and maintain database of executed wins • Build and maintain a strong partnership between IT and Finance; continuous updates shared • Education, mentoring, and training to raise awareness about cost optimization best practices across the organization Continuous Improvement: • Stay updated on cloud services, pricing models, and industry trends • Recommend and implement process improvements to enhance cost optimization efforts • Monitor and assess the effectiveness of cost-saving initiatives using key metrics defined
